Even in the age of google, most artists love their art books. I’ve gathered a treasured collection, found mostly at op shops and from secondhand book sellers. A few years ago I picked up Sargent at Broadway: The Impressionist Years, stamped ‘withdrawn from the Sunshine Coast Libraries stock and offered for sale with all faults’. This gem of a book is a record of outdoor paintings and informal portraits by John Singer Sargent painted during his summers spent in Broadway and nearby English towns, from 1883 to 1889. I read it with a feeling of nostalgia, wishing I’d been part of such a time, artists (with loved ones and friends) hanging out in nature painting en plein air.

I’ve had some of the happiest times of my life painting little snapshots of nature and enjoying ‘picnic and paint’ with my wife. We could be in any era, by any river, mountain or ocean. All I need now is a bateau-atelier (boat studio), life couldn’t get any better than that!
